ADVERTISEMENT LinkedIn is introducing new ways to engage with posts, adding four new reactions alongside the like button. In an announcement, the company says users are regularly asking for more expressive ways to respond to different posts. Users are also asking for new ways to understand why people like their posts. A majority of small businesses (SMBs) surveyed understand they should be doing SEO but only 36 percent have an SEO strategy in place and are actively pursuing it. That’s according to a survey of 529 small businesses, between 1 and 50+ employees conducted by The Manifest. Beyond the 36 percent, the survey found another 23…

Facebook announced a dramatic update to it’s news feed designed to limit the reach of pages and groups that violate it’s content policies. Facebook introduced a new algorithm signal focused on links that decides whether a site has authority and if not, will see it’s news feed reach diminished.
